Kingdoms of Amalur: Reckoning Demo Hacked- Showcase Of Every Move

In four days, BillsGaming had hacked the demo, thus granting him access to every move in the game, an extended playtime, and maximum stats for his skills. BillsGaming decided to share his work with the world via a gaming series that goes through every move for the various classes.

Electronic Arts Claims "Strong" End of Fiscal Year as Split Fiction Has Sold Nearly 4 Million Units

Today, Electronic Arts announced its financial results for the fourth quarter of its fiscal year 2025, alongside the full year.
Split Fiction has sold nearly 4 million copies, and the next battlefield is confirmed for a release by March 2026 with a reveal this Summer.

EA Cuts Around 300 Roles, Including Roughly 100 at Respawn

In addition to the roughly 100 job cuts IGN reported earlier today at Respawn Entertainment, EA has made wider cuts across its organization today, impacting around 300 individuals total including those already reported at Respawn.
